# Understanding the Evolution of Virtual Training Content

Virtual training content has come a long way from static PowerPoint presentations and outdated webinars. Today, it encompasses a wide array of interactive and engaging formats such as virtual reality (VR) experiences, gamified learning modules, and real-time collaboration tools. These advancements not only make learning more accessible but also more effective, fostering a more dynamic and inclusive learning environment.

One of the most significant trends in virtual training content is the integration of AI and machine learning. These technologies can personalize learning experiences, offering tailored content based on individual learner preferences and performance. For example, an AI-driven platform can analyze a learner's progress and provide customized feedback and recommendations, enhancing the overall learning experience.

# Innovations in Real-Time Collaboration Tools

Real-time collaboration tools are a game-changer in remote team collaboration. These tools allow team members to work together in real-time, regardless of their physical locations. From document editing and project management to virtual brainstorming sessions, these tools facilitate seamless communication and enhance team cohesion.

One of the most innovative tools in this space is the integration of digital whiteboards. Unlike traditional whiteboards, digital whiteboards can be accessed and edited by multiple users simultaneously, making it easier to brainstorm and collaborate on projects. Additionally, these tools often come with features like annotation, highlighting, and voice notes, which can be invaluable during remote meetings and discussions.

# Future Developments: The Role of Augmented Reality (AR) in Training

Augmented Reality (AR) is set to revolutionize the way we deliver virtual training content. AR technology can overlay digital information onto the real world, providing a more immersive and interactive learning experience. For instance, in a manufacturing setting, AR can be used to provide step-by-step instructions for assembly, making it easier for workers to learn and execute tasks accurately.

Moreover, AR can be particularly useful in training scenarios that require hands-on experience. For example, medical professionals can use AR to practice surgeries or procedures in a controlled virtual environment. This not only enhances their skills but also reduces the risk of errors in real-world scenarios.

# Best Practices for Implementing Virtual Training Content

To maximize the effectiveness of virtual training content, it's crucial to adopt best practices. Here are a few key strategies:

1. Engage with Interactive Content: Incorporate multimedia elements like videos, animations, and quizzes to keep learners engaged. Interactive content not only makes the learning process more enjoyable but also helps reinforce key concepts.

2. Foster a Community of Learners: Encourage collaboration and peer-to-peer learning by creating forums or chat groups where learners can discuss their progress and ask questions. This not only enhances learning but also builds a sense of community among team members.

3. Regular Feedback and Assessment: Provide regular feedback to learners and conduct assessments to gauge their understanding. This helps identify areas where additional support may be needed and ensures that learners are on track to achieve their learning goals.

4. Continuous Improvement: Stay updated with the latest trends and innovations in virtual training content. Regularly update your training materials to incorporate new technologies and best practices, ensuring that your team remains at the forefront of remote collaboration.
